我有這些models.InterChoices
class LogType(models.IntegerChoices):
SYSTEM_OK = 1
SYSTEM_REPLY = 2
SYSTEM_ERROR = 5
我可以獲得選擇框的選擇,例如LogType.choices()
現在,我想得到name
例如,我想這樣做
LogType.get_by_id(1)回傳SYSTEM_OK或System Ok
可能嗎??
uj5u.com熱心網友回復:
您可以使用 的建構式LogType,因此:
item = LogType(1)
然后,您可以使用item.label, 或item.name來獲取名稱。例如:
>>> item = LogType(1)
>>> item.label
'System Ok'
>>> item.name
'SYSTEM_OK'
轉載請註明出處,本文鏈接:https://www.uj5u.com/gongcheng/442509.html
